Alexander Wang:
Hair (Guido Palau for Redken): This has to be the craziest hair we’ve ever seen Wang do. Palau had a bunch of extensions dyed the color of model Irina Kravchenko’s hair; Wang loved her hair color when she walked for him last season–it was dubbed “cognac.” Palau wanted the models’ hair to look “cloned” and have a futuristic effect. He essentially “took away the girls’ personalities” by slicking everyone’s hair back and then making the red extensions into a wrapped ponytail, which fit perfectly through holes cut through hoods in the garments.
Makeup (Diane Kendal for MAC): Kendal warned that this isn’t really a look that will translate to real life–the super contoured matte eye (grey shadow in the contour and grey “grease” up to the brow) made the models’ eyes look a bit hollowed out.
Nails (Jan Arnold for CND): The color on the nails creeped us out a bit, but the technique was pretty interesting. Arnold used a fan brush to make an almost streaky, gradient, matte look in a sandstone color (Impossibly Plush). She had used the same technique on her own nails, but done in a metallic grey it looked much more real world and less runway.
